阿里Java测试一面面经

本来是投的后端开发,但是二面没过,评估之后给我转投到了同部门的测试岗招聘
刚开始接到电话还有点懵,因为我不懂测试开发,但是后来再三强调技术会不会没关系,主要是问我感不感兴趣
当时不知道今年可以投三个部门,所以就接受了测试岗的面试,一面是电话面,时长30min
上来先问了问项目,怎么实现限购,以及如何避免超卖等等,后面就是问了点基础知识
基础知识:
1. 项目开发中都用到了什么Java数据类型(没错,就是这么简单,我也不知道为啥要问这个)
2. Map和Set的区别
3. HashMap线程安全么?如果不安全如何保证线程安全?
4. ConcurrentHashMap如何实现线程安全的?
5. 介绍下SpringBoot,SpringBoot与Spring的区别?SpringBoot如何实现自动装配jar包的?
6. 项目开发中如何导入jar包,具体的操作流程
7. 项目中具体都写了哪些部分的代码
8. 有对项目做过测试嘛,怎么测试的
大概就这些了,其他的想不起来了。。。

再后来就问了问学校关于实习方面的规定,最快什么时候入职,能实习多久,会不会影响学业之类的问题了

感觉阿里的一面相比于二面的确简单不少,两次一面可以交流的比较顺畅,要是二面也这么简单就好了


#面经##阿里巴巴##测试工程师##Java#
全部评论
希望楼主成功入职,期待二面三面经验分析
点赞 回复 分享
发布于 2021-03-17 15:50
哪个部门啊
点赞 回复 分享
发布于 2021-03-17 14:29
校招吧
点赞 回复 分享
发布于 2021-03-16 16:13

相关推荐

DKS233:(1)专业技能:Java8也太旧了,最少也要了解到JDK17吧,可以参考现在SpringBoot支持的Java最低版本,熟悉mysql基本理论具体指啥,是锁这种具体原理还是分库分表这些业务场景,spring这些专业词汇,大小写要写对(全篇简历都有这个问题,显得不严谨),熟悉使用框架进行业务开发就别写了,如果要写,起码要写到框架原理部分吧,比如aop,启动原理什么的,springcloud具体指哪些模块呢,写清楚,网关还是鉴权还是什么,“改造”没必要写吧,你直接说用springcloud开发的不就行了(2)项目经历:首先格式就有大问题,时间怎么能换行呢,调整一下,响应速度那个,如果指的是将部分数据从其他数据库转到redis的提升就别写了,因为这个不算难点,redis可以写写分布式这些,比如容灾怎么实现的,数据库同步怎么做的
点赞 评论 收藏
分享
评论
3
23
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务